12 Ways To Achieve A Happier New Year
Odyssey

1. Learn to open up.

Sometimes it's easier to keep everything closed in because we don't want to be vulnerable to another person and face the potential of getting our feelings hurt. Stop closing yourself off this year because when you finally open up to someone you will begin to connect on a new level. Also you never know what opportunities may arise from it.

2. Say I love you more...and mean it.

We toss "I love you" around either way too much or not at all. This should be the year that you tell the important people in your life how you love and appreciate them, but only if you mean it. This year don't be afraid to tell someone how you may feel.

3. Say yes.

There are times we wait for the "right thing" to come around and we let many opportunities because of it. This is the year to say yes to more opportunities that come your way.

4. Do what you are passionate about every day.

At the end of the day you should lay your head on your pillow and be totally satisfied with what you have done in your day. This can be done by doing what you love; it can be something as small as taking time to read, exercise, etc. Do what you love because when you do, part of your day feels less like a responsibility and more like happy living.

5. Forgive.

Harboring harsh feelings toward someone is exhausting so this is the year you let it all go. Forgiving doesn't mean forgetting, but it is time to free yourself of the angry burden.

6. Eat well & exercise.

This ones pretty self explanatory. If you treat your body well, you will feel well. Do this by eating your greens, exercising often, stretching, and getting a good night sleep. This will improve both your physical and mental health.

7. Set goals and take actions towards them.

At the start of the year make a list of goals you want to accomplish this year. By doing this, you are holding yourself accountable to your goals and this will encourage you to take action towards them. Dream big because there is no such thing as too large of a goal.

8. Be grateful for the things you have by giving to others.

Take time to look around and realize how lucky you are. Be thankful for the things we most often take for granted. When you finally realize how fortunate you are, then it is time to give back to others. You can do this by donating old clothes, volunteering at shelters, assistant living homes, etc.

9. Let go of things you can’t control and realize that nothing can be perfect.

I know for me I strive to be perfect in everything, but what we all need to realize is that no one is perfect. We need to stop trying to achieve perfection by embracing our flaws. This year you need to stop trying to control everything to create the perfect year. There are many things in life that we cannot control so embrace whatever life throws at you.

10. Remove the negativity from your life.

This is the year to cut the negativity out of your life. This includes an stressors, toxic relationships, horrible places, etc. It may seem impossible to cut out a person or place in your life, but you will find that by removing negative energy from your life, you will be lighter and freer.

11. Stop trying to please others, please yourself.

This is the year you put yourself first. Take time for yourself. With everything that you do, do it for yourself, not anyone else. Because in the end you will be happier and more confident in yourself.

12. Let go of what happened yesterday.

Last year was last year. It is time to move forward by letting go of yesterday and start looking forward to tomorrow. Things in our past have shaped us, but they do not control us. Appreciate your history, learn from it, but force of the future.
